Built a site in the Wix Editor? Transferring it to Wix Studio allows you to rebuild the site with advanced design options - all while keeping the site's dashboard and data.
Moving from Wix Editor to Studio creates a new version (branch) of the site that you can edit separately. This doesn't unpublish or affect the original site, so you and your clients won't have to worry about downtime. Learn more about Wix Studio branches.
Important:
If you choose to create a Wix Studio branch, there are some things to keep in mind:
- It's only possible to create a Wix Studio version of a Wix Editor site with a Premium plan. If you choose to publish the Studio version of the site, you will need to upgrade to a Wix Studio plan.
- If you publish the Studio branch, it is not possible to go back and republish the original Wix Editor branch.
Creating the Wix Studio branch
To get started, create a Wix Studio branch of an existing Wix Editor site. Branches share most data and apps, so you don't need to worry about losing any of the site's information.
Good to know:
The design of the site is not carried over to the Wix Studio branch. You can build the new version in the Studio Editor to create the design you want.
To create and edit the Studio version of the site:
- Go to Sites in your Wix account.
- Click Site Actions
beside the relevant Wix Editor site. - Select Create a version on Studio.
- Click Create Studio Version.

Setting up and designing your Studio branch
After you've created your Studio branch, access the editor to begin designing. When you first open the Studio Editor, apps you previously added in the Wix Editor are automatically installed to your Studio branch.
To set up and design a Studio branch:
- Go to your site's dashboard.
- Click Site & Mobile App.
- Select Website under Website & SEO.
- Click Edit beside the Studio branch.
- Allow apps to finish installing and click Get Started (if relevant).
- Begin working on the site. Here are some ways to get started:
- Create and manage pages to build the branch the way you want.
- Add sections and cells to structure your page content.
- Use the Site Styles panel to create a consistent, custom design.

Manually adding your apps
You may notice that an app you installed in the Wix Editor version was not carried over to the Studio branch. Some apps are unsupported in Studio, and therefore cannot be added.
However, some apps are not carried over due to a technical issue on our end. You can always manually add them from the My Business panel if that's the case.
To add an existing app to the Studio branch:
- Open the Studio branch in your editor.
- Click My Business
on the left side of your editor. - Click the tab of the relevant app.
- Click Add to Branch.

Managing site branches
You can manage site branches from your editor, no matter which version you're working on. Rename branches so they're easy to identify, and delete branches you no longer need.
To manage site branches:
- Open a site branch in your editor.
- Click the Version icon
at the top. - Select an option to manage your branches:
- Rename: Choose a name for the branch that makes it easy to identify:
- Type the new name into the field.
- Press Enter on your keyboard.
- Delete: Delete a branch you no longer need:
- Click Go to Dashboard.
- Click the Delete Branch icon
next to the relevant branch. - Click Delete Branch.

Notes:
- It is not possible to delete the site branch that is currently published.
- If you delete the site's only Studio branch, the site is reverted back to the Wix Editor experience.
Publishing the Studio Editor branch
Ready to complete the move to Wix Studio? Publish the Studio branch from your editor. This automatically unpublishes the live Wix Editor branch but doesn't delete it, providing an easy transition for you and your clients.
Before you publish:
- We recommend checking that the design and content are ready, and that all of the relevant apps are installed.
- Publishing a new branch can affect the site's SEO. Make sure to optimize the branch pages and content to minimize the impact.
- Once you publish the Studio branch, it is not possible to go back and republish the original Wix Editor branch.
Reminder:
In order to publish the Studio version of the site, you need a Wix Studio plan. If the site doesn't have a Studio plan, you can use the steps below to upgrade it.
To publish the Studio branch:
- Open the Studio branch in your editor.
- Click Publish on the top-right.
- Follow the steps depending on the site's plan:
- Site has a Studio plan:
- Click Publish.
- Click Done.
- Site does not have a Studio plan:
- Click Continue.
- Click Change Plan & Publish Site.
- Click Done.
